Output 3af109e1215bad9875353836c227d8cd58c9236fa2966aaa0e3917fbbf053023:0

value
560000
script pubkey
OP_0 OP_PUSHBYTES_20 267577e84dd286356ec340e987c67c9e44913527
address
bc1qye6h06zd62rr2mkrgr5c03nunezfzdf8yqjqje
transaction
3af109e1215bad9875353836c227d8cd58c9236fa2966aaa0e3917fbbf053023
spent
true